In the constantly shifting landscape of digital media, crafting compelling web experiences is a delicate art form. It demands a blend of creative vision and technical expertise to captivate users and convey brand messages effectively. A skilled web designer combines user-centered design principles with the latest technologies to build websites that are both visually appealing and functionally powerful.
- Comprehending user needs is paramount. By performing thorough research, designers can obtain valuable insights into target audiences, their desires, and their online patterns.
- Content architecture plays a essential role in organizing content logically. A well-structured website allows users to navigate effortlessly, finding the materials they seek.
- Visual design elements enhance the overall user experience. From scheme selection to styling, designers thoughtfully choose elements that represent the brand's identity and create a memorable impression.
Responsive design is essential for ensuring a seamless experience across screens. A well-designed website responds to different screen sizes, providing an optimal viewing experience for users on tablets.

Unveiling the Mysteries of Code: A Beginner's Guide to Programming Languages
Programming languages can seem like excel programmers a daunting mystery, but they are essentially just tools for communicating with computers. These languages provide a set of instructions that tell the computer what to do, allowing us to create everything from simple programs to complex systems. Learning a programming language can be an incredibly rewarding experience, opening up a world of possibilities for creativity and innovation.
There are many different types of programming languages, each with its own strengths and weaknesses. Some popular choices include Python, Java, C++, and JavaScript. The best language for you will depend on your aspirations and the type of projects you want to create.
- Furthermore, understanding the basic concepts of programming can be helpful even if you don't plan on becoming a professional programmer. It can enhance your problem-solving skills and give you a deeper appreciation for the technology that surrounds us.
